Teflon, a synthetic fluoropolymer, was discovered by chemist Roy Plunkett in 1938 and has since become a staple material in industries ranging from aerospace to food processing. Teflon rods, in particular, are known for their exceptional non-stick and heat-resistant properties. This makes them ideal for use in applications where high temperatures and resistance to chemicals are required.

One of the most common uses of Teflon rods is as bearings and seals in industrial machinery. The low coefficient of friction of Teflon helps reduce wear and tear on moving parts, leading to longer machine life and reduced maintenance costs. In addition, the non-stick properties of Teflon prevent the buildup of debris and contaminants, ensuring smooth operation of machinery.

Teflon rods are also widely used in the food industry due to their non-stick properties and resistance to high temperatures. From baking and confectionery to food packaging and processing, Teflon rods play a key role in ensuring the quality and safety of food products. Their heat-resistant properties make them ideal for use in ovens, grills, and other cooking equipment, while their non-stick surface makes them easy to clean and maintain.

In the medical and pharmaceutical industries, Teflon rods are used in a variety of applications, including as coatings for medical devices, seals for drug containers, and components in laboratory equipment. The biocompatibility of Teflon makes it safe for use in contact with human tissues and fluids, while its resistance to chemicals and high temperatures ensures the reliability and durability of medical devices.

Teflon rods are also commonly used in electrical and electronic applications due to their high dielectric strength and resistance to heat and chemicals. From insulating wires and cables to protecting sensitive electronic components, Teflon rods help ensure the reliable performance of electrical and electronic systems. In addition, their non-stick properties make them easy to clean and maintain, reducing the risk of contamination and malfunctions.

In the aerospace and automotive industries, Teflon rods are used in a wide range of applications, including as seals, gaskets, and insulating materials. The heat-resistant and chemically inert properties of Teflon make it ideal for use in high-temperature and high-pressure environments, such as aircraft engines and automotive transmissions. In addition, the low friction of Teflon helps reduce wear and tear on moving parts, leading to improved efficiency and performance.
